SAN DIEGO (Nov. 8, 2021) Secretary of the Navy Carlos Del Toro meets with Navy divers assigned to Naval Special Warfare (NSW) units during a visit to the San Diego area. During the visit, Del Toro spent time with NSW personnel to discuss ongoing digital transformation and innovation efforts, integrating NSW assets with the Fleet, and assessing and selecting leaders with character, cognitive and leadership attributes. Naval Special Warfare is the nation's premier maritime special operations force, uniquely positioned to extend the fleet's reach and deliver all-domain options for naval and joint force commanders.
